Output 138358c84e4ed4084d09b97382c7f223a873d28b75464f695245d8e17a48be3d:1

value
570298
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bb8e4865a7bbc986cad658123bcace18264b0e2 OP_EQUAL
address
MKBLqbP9uJAWwaeDHzP2F3U9uprPNLsYYL
transaction
138358c84e4ed4084d09b97382c7f223a873d28b75464f695245d8e17a48be3d
spent
true